The Awareness Party (TAP) in brief:

The Awareness Party –‘ TAP’ is about ‘turning you on to politics’!

The Awareness Party acknowledges that we are all connected, and that Gaia is a living system! It is based on 7 ethical principles that represent a foundation for the party, for business or any institution that should choose to use them.

In the past, government was religious; then secular; and now we need to correct the balance by including a ‘conscious’ foundation on which to base our political and economic systems.

The application of the first principle, ‘oneness’, to all policies means that we accept that all people are one energy – that of humanity. We accept that no one human is more valuable than another. It means that no one race colour or creed has dominance over another, here or anywhere. This is considered to be an unshakable fact. When applied, this one principle will make a difference to every policy that we develop.

The main focus of the Awareness Party is to move the human race away from possible extinction, because that is where the human race is heading, closer every day, and humanity is burying its collective head in the sand saying, “She’ll be right!”.

The way to move forwards is through:

  1. Sustainability and environmentalism.
  2. Fewer extremes between rich and poor.
  3. Non violence in all circumstances.
  4. New structures of government, governance, economics and trade.
  5. Encouraging community and decentralisation

These can be expressed through various policies that will be developed but include

a) The country will work together to create a vision that will be held by a council of elders, or upper house, so that all policy will have to  be held accountable to that vision, whatever party is in government.

b)  The three year election cycle will be abolished and a four or five year one will replace it. Binding Citizens Initiated Referendums will be encouraged on any controversial issues.

c)   Organic and biodynamic farming

d)  Funding an outstandingly innovative education system – that is supportive of both students and teachers

e)   Non violent communication will be taught in all schools and will be funded so as to be able to be used right through the community.

f)   The Awareness Party promotes decentralisation and community living where ever possible. Local food production will be at the centre of this. We will create initiatives to actively involve people in local community activities and government and ‘people power’ initiatives.

TAP is dedicated to promoting positivity and so will couch its communications in positive terms: eg

-The Awareness Party applauds New Zealanders who have stood for national parks free of mining.

-The Awareness Party is keen to see New Zealand’s beaches available to all for recreation or conservation.

-The Awareness Party supports all moves to keep water, and other government owned assets in the hands of public institutions and not private profiteers.

The Awareness Party is keen to see honesty, openness, and accountability from our political figures and all leaders.

The 7 Principles are:

7. Oneness

6. Awareness

5. Kindness

4. Compassion

3. Self responsibility

2. Balance

1. Community
